Re: mdadm --monitor an mehrere Mail-Accounts
Boris Andratzek wrote:
> Hallo zusammen,
>
>
> ich habe nach einiger Bastelei auf einem entfernten Rechner ein
> Software-Raid mit mdadm in Benutzung. Klasse Sache das.
> Ich würde nun gerne haben, dass das Monitor-Tool einen eventuellen
> Fehler an mehrere Mail-Adressen sendet. Dazu habe ich in der
> dialog-gestützten Konfiguration einfach zwei Adressen (mit Komma und
> Blank getrennt) angegeben, so dass der laufende Prozess jetzt so aussieht:
>
> root 2206 0.0 0.5 1696 692 ? Ss 11:35 0:00
> /sbin/mdadm -F -i /var/run/mdadm.pid -m adresse1@monitor1.de,
> adresse2@monitor2.de -f -s
>
> Ich habe allerdings Sorge, dass das nicht funktioniert! Frage also: Wie
> kann ich das Testen ohne von einer Platte die Stromversorgung
> abzuziehen) und wie kann ich die Anforderung erfüllen?
Ich schreib' mir selbst... und zwecks Doku eben auch an die Liste!
Man kann mit
mdadm /dev/md0 --fail /dev/hdx
ein Device in den Fehlerstatus befördern. Dann sollte der Monitor die
Alert-Mail absetzen.
Nach einem Reboot war zumindest das RAID1 auf meinem Testsystem wieder
fit. Zu überprüfen mit
cat /proc/mdstat
Bei dem RAID5, um das es geht, reichte der Reboot nicht (ist ja sowieso
der schlechte Weg), sondern der Rebuild wurde erst angeschubst nach
mdadm --add /dev/md0 /dev/hdd1
Das ganze habe ich verschiedenen Konfigurationen des Monitors
vorgenommen. Ergebnis: Man kann die Alert-Mail an mehrere Adressen
absetzen. Trennen durch Komma, aber ohne Blank.
Vielleicht interessiert's jemanden!
:-)
Boris
Reply to: